This beginner- friendly volume is a detailed account on leadership in the rapidly changing business environment in India, offering classical as well as emerging models of leadership. Through illustrative case studies, research and self-assessment instruments, it maps the frameworks, perspectives and skill sets required for an individual contributor to evolve into a true leader.

This book includes a wide range of themes, current and emergent: leading a spiritual workplace, remote leadership, digital leadership, agile leadership, leading with stories, among others. It expounds on how the leader can be a coach as well as the designer of a spiritual workplace. It also illuminates some practices and measures, such as yoga, that can help employees grappling with the problems of perceived loss of meaning and purpose, leading to a spiritual deficit.

This book will be useful to the students, academicians, industry professionals and management researchers of organisational behaviour, general management, and human resource management and development. It would also be an indispensable resource for management development programmes on leadership.

Amitabha Sengupta currently teaches Leadership, Organization Behaviour, Negotiations and Human Resources Management. He holds a masters degree from Calcutta University, a Post Graduate Honours Diploma from XLRI and a Diploma in Human Resources Management from Corneil University. His publications include Human Resources Management: Concepts, Practices and New Paradigms and a two-part case study, Infinity Insurance: Creating a New Organization.

Professor Sengupta, prior to taking up teaching, has had a successful corporate career in reputed organizations like Bharat Petroleum Corporation Ltd (Oil PSU) and Union Carbide India Ltd (MNC) for about 35 years. He is also a Management Consultant, Leadership Assessor and an Executive Coach.
